There are a few things about Christmas that make it stick out as a holiday. One of the Christmas traits that would let anybody driving down a road know that it was the Christmas season is the Christmas yard decorations. White Christmas lights hanging from houses and trees to light up the night have been a trademark of the Christmas season for years.

Some homes have an incredible array of outdoor lighting. This can take a large amount of electricity. A large amount of lights can even require its own circuit. Over the years, the lighting industry has worked hard to make white Christmas lights more energy efficient. For example, commercial mini bulbs have taken the place of most larger bulbs in commercial christmas lighting. To enhance savings even more, lighting industries are beginning to offer LED Christmas lights.
